    Hey there; it’s my first ever grow & any advice would be helpful. My setup is a VIVOSUN VGrow box with Mexican Rush Auto from RQS in a 3gal fabric pot with Foxfarm BushDoctor CoCo-LoCo using Humboldts Secret Nutrients(CalMag → Base A → Base B → Plant Enzymes → Tree Trunk → Flower Stacker → Sticky & Sweet) . I’m running a VIVOSUN dehumidifier & damprid, aerowave d4 fan, exhale CO2 bag. I had been running a drip system that was doing 40mL per minute but I couldn’t figure a right duration & was overwatering so I switched to hand watering every 48hrs with approx.950-1150ml each watering. | trimmed all the fan leaves & anything that was below that wasn’t getting much light. I was worried that I had made the plant go into shock or something because it was day 37 of flowering & the bud sites weren’t  growing bigger/bulking. It’s currently in Day 51 of flowering the plant definitely looks better than what it did after the trim but I’m worried since it’s so late in flowering the bud sites & plant is screwed . I will attach pictures with texts

    Current Water Ph: 5.9-6.2

    Current Water PPM: 957ppm

    Current Water EC : 1900-2000ec

    Temp Range: 68-82*F

    Humidity: 40-60%

    Co2: 500-1400ppm

    First off, congrats on your first ever grow. Most of what you mention are good conditions like: water ph range, water ppm, temp range, humidity range, co2 range – all of those are in acceptable ranges. You mention 1900-2000ec which I’m assuming is actually PPM? Unless you mean 1.9-2.0 EC ?

    Looking at the plant, I see some purple stems and 3-finger leaves which makes me believe the plant either went through a deficiency or a lockout at some point. The plant size and buds do appear to be small this late into flower. Was the plant stunted in Veg or flower? Also, do you every check the PPM of the coco runoff?
